Why Is My House Hotter At Night?

It feels like your house is always warmer at night than it was during the day. You turn up the thermostat lower, but the temperature just won't budge. There are a few reasons why this occurs. One factor is that your house has had all day to absorb heat from the sun. The walls, floors, and even the furniture will have held some of that heat. At night, when the sun isn't shining anymore, this stored heat starts to escape back into your house, making it feel warmer.

Another reason is insulation. If your house doesn't have good insulation, heat can easily drift out during the day and sneak back in at night. Finally, your heating system may be running more frequently at night because here it's trying to compensate for the extra heat in the house.

  • Make sure your windows and doors are well-insulated to prevent heat from entering or escaping.
  • Employ heavy curtains or blinds to block out the sun's rays during the day.
  • Check your insulation levels and add more if necessary.
  • Invest in a programmable thermostat to help you manage the temperature at night.

Why Your House Gets Warmer After Dark

As the sun sets, a curious thing often happens. Your house may start to warmer, even though it's getting dark outside. This shift in temperature isn't just a trick of your perception; there are several scientific factors at play.

One key factor is heat absorption. During the day, your roof and walls absorb large amounts of solar energy. As the sun goes down, this accumulated heat gradually radiates back into your home.

Another factor is the lack of sunlight's warming effect. During the day, sunlight helps raise the temperature of both your home and the surrounding air. At night, with no sunlight warming influence ceases.
